★ 2012: (Partner Kaleb Driggers) Won Round 10 of the Wrangler NFR in a time of 4.0, earned a share of first place in Round 1 and placed in four other rounds in between to win his first gold buckle with season earnings of $190,797. Won the Reno (Nev.) Rodeo; Rodeo Austin; the Grand National Rodeo (San Francisco, Calif.), with Justin Wade Davis; the Pikes Peak or Bust Rodeo Days (Colorado Springs, Colo.); the Snake River Stampede (Nampa, Idaho); the Kitsap Stampede (Bremerton, Wash.) and the Kern County Fair Rodeo (Bakersfield, Calif.), with Wade Wheatley. Won the all-around and was co-champion in the team roping at the Rowell Ranch Rodeo (Hayward, Calif.), with Zayne Dishion ★ 2011: (Partner Chad Masters) Won Rounds 9 and 10 of the Wrangler NFR and placed in three other rounds. Won the American Royal Rodeo (Kansas City, Mo.); the San Antonio Stock Show & Rodeo; the Greeley (Colo.) Independence Stampede; the Wild Bill Hickok Rodeo (Abilene, Kan.); the Sisters (Ore.) Rodeo; the Norco (Calif.) Mounted Posse Rodeo and the Kern County Fair Rodeo (Bakersfield, Calif.), with Wade Wheatley. Co-champion at the Mother Lode Round-up (Sonora, Calif.), with Britt Williams. Finished fourth in the world standings with $152,976 ★ 2010: (Partner Chad Masters) Placed in four rounds of the Wrangler NFR, including a win in Round 10 with a time of 3.9 seconds. Finished fifth in the world standings with $164,456. Won the 100th Pendleton (Ore.) Round-Up; the 100th California Rodeo Salinas; the Dodge City (Kan.) Round-Up; the Walker County Fair & Rodeo (Huntsville, Texas); the Livingston (Mont.) Round-Up and the Deadwood (S.D.) Days of ‘76 Rodeo ★ 2009: (Partner Chad Masters) Won Round 9 of the Wrangler National Finals Rodeo with a world-record time of 3.3 seconds; placed in three additional rounds. Broke the record for regular-season earnings by a team roper with $127,749 and finished fourth in the world standings with $157,532. Won the Cheyenne (Wyo.) Frontier Days Rodeo; the Clovis (Calif.) Rodeo; the Lea County Fair & PRCA Rodeo (Lovington, N.M.); the Snake River Stampede (Nampa, Idaho); the Central Wyoming Fair & Rodeo (Casper); the Livermore (Calif.) Rodeo; the Norco (Calif.) Mounted Posse Rodeo and the Wild Bill Hickok Rodeo (Abilene, Kan.). (Partner Michael Jones). Won the Sandhills Stock Show & Rodeo (Odessa, Texas) and the National Western Stock Show & Rodeo (Denver) ★ 2008: Placed in seven of 10 rounds of the Wrangler NFR with Luke Brown and finished third in the average. Finished second in the world standings to fellow Nevadan Randon Adams with $166,673. (Partner Chad Masters) Won RodeoHouston; the Spanish Fork (Utah) Fiesta Days Rodeo and the Larimer County Fair & Rodeo (Loveland, Colo.). Won the Caldwell (Idaho) Night Rodeo (first round, Tour Playoffs), with Jake Stanley ★ 2007: Won the Guymon (Okla.) Pioneer Days Rodeo, with Chris Lawson ★ 2006: Won the Kit Carson County Fair & Rodeo (Burlington, Colo.), with Blaine Linaweaver; won the Wrangler ProRodeo Tour and average title at Rodeo Austin (Texas), with Matt Tyler; co-champion at the Brawley (Calif.) Cattle Call Rodeo, with Logan Olson Awards PRCA Team Roping (heeler) Rookie of the Year, 2006. Horse Fine Snip of Doc“Cave Man”voted AQHA/PRCA Team Roping Heeling Horse of the Year, 2010 and again in 2012 Amateur Nevada high school team roping and tie-down roping champion, 2005. World Junior Team Roping champion (with Joel Bach), 2005 Personal 6-1, 215 ... Wife, Haley (married April 28, 2013); sons, Colby (born Feb. 28, 2011) and Kelton (born Feb. 14, 2014) ... Graduated from high school in May 2006 after being home schooled ... Jade bought his permit in August 2005, when he turned 18, and competed at about five rodeos in California before filling his permit ... Roped his first steer, a wooden one, in the family living room when he was 1 year old and won his first check at age 6 ... Primary competition horse is Cave Man... Sister, Bailey, competed in rodeo for the University of Nevada-Las Vegas (UNLV) ... Favorite rodeo is Rodeo California Salinas
